At a Glance
- Tasks: Manage document flow and support the project team with vital information.
- Company: Leading developer with exciting residential projects in Hertfordshire.
- Benefits: Competitive salary up to £45,000 plus a comprehensive package.
- Other info: Hybrid role transitioning to full site-based work as the project progresses.
- Why this job: Be a key player in major developments and enhance your career in a dynamic environment.
- Qualifications: 5 years' experience with Viewpoint or 4 Project required.
The predicted salary is between 36000 - 54000 £ per year.

How to prepare for a job interview at Borne Resourcing Limited
✨Know Your Viewpoint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of Viewpoint or 4 Project. Familiarise yourself with its features and functionalities, as you'll likely be asked how you've used it in past roles. Being able to discuss specific examples will show that you're not just familiar but proficient.
✨Showcase Your Document Management Skills
Prepare to discuss your experience in managing document flows and how you've ensured efficiency in previous projects. Think of specific instances where your skills made a difference, and be ready to explain your approach to maintaining accuracy and consistency.
✨Understand the Project Team Dynamics
Since you'll be the first point of contact for the EDMS, it's crucial to understand how different team members rely on document control. Research the typical roles in a site team and be prepared to discuss how you would support them effectively.
✨Be Ready for Hybrid Work Questions
As the role starts hybrid, be prepared to discuss your experience with remote collaboration tools and how you manage your time and productivity in a hybrid setting. Highlight any strategies you've used to stay connected with teams while working remotely.
